This 4.8 acre island is located just three hours northwest of Minneapolis in a very interesting part of Minnesota. While there are open grassy areas around the three authentic log cabins the older edges of the island have been seated in wildflowers and the whole effect is magical. Let your kids and dogs roam free without worrying about encountering others.

Inside the main cabin you will find scores of railroad antiques and memoribilia to entertain kids of all ages! The authentic log cabins were crafted by Amish families in the early 2000's and are beautiful. The cabins are air conditions and have Wi-fi and are very comfortable. The island also has a hand hewn cedar log sauna that hs a convenient electric sauna just a few feet from where you can jump in the lake and swim to our floating dock. The jewel of the island is the Tea House located in the center of the island. This is a one of a kind masterpiece of design and craft and sports a screened area in case the mosquitos are out in force(usually the mosquitos are blown off the island in a breeze).

There are multiple yard games supplied and we will guarantee you will have a wonderful time at this one of a kind paradise. You will need to bring your own boat to access the island which is less than 1/4 mile from landing. We have a pontoon available if you would like to rent at a very good rate
